BEAUTIFUL PLAINS TEACHERS' ASSOCIATION

EFFECTIVE PERIOD: 2020/07/01 - 2022/06/30

Article 14: Substitute Teachers

14.01 Rates

Payment for a substitute teacher shall be $159.20 per day including holiday pay. Those substitute teachers who work less than a full day shall be paid the prorated amount grossed up by 20%. The grossed up daily pay shall not exceed the standard daily rate stated above. This rate will apply for the duration of the collective agreement.

14.02 Consecutive Substitution

After 5 consecutive days of substitution for the same teacher, effective the 6th day, the per diem allowance shall be based on the annual substitute’s salary on scale divided by the number of days in the school year. Substitute teachers shall not be eligible for wages, benefits, or rights under this collective agreement except as may be specifically covered in Article 15.

14.03 Regular Contract

A substitute teacher is employed by the Division to either replace a regular teacher or fulfill an assignment which is less than twenty (20) days in duration.

 

A substitute teacher who has been employed for at least twenty (20) days of extended substitute teaching shall, on the twenty-first (21) day, be signed to a Limited Term Teacher General Contract, unless the return of the regular teacher or conclusion of the substitute assignment will occur within five (5) working days.

14.04 Manitoba Teachers' Society Fees

Manitoba Teachers’ Society fees and Association fees shall be deducted from a substitute teacher’s pay monthly. These fees shall be pro-rated on the basis of the number of days worked in a given month.

 

The Association shall indemnify and save harmless the Division from any and all losses, costs, liabilities or expenses suffered or sustained by the Division as a result of any claim or legal action arising from the deduction of local Association fees or Manitoba Teachers’ Society fees.

14.05 Payment of Salary

Substitute teachers shall be paid no later than the 15th of the month after which they worked.

14.06 Sick Leave

A substitute teacher who has been employed for at least nine (9) consecutive days of extended substitute teaching in a school year shall be entitled to one (1) day of sick leave with pay for each nine (9) days taught in that assignment.  Sick leave shall not accumulate from assignment to assignment.

14.07 Interruption of Duties

The use of sick leave with pay shall not constitute an interruption of the extended substitute teaching assignment.

14.08 Definition of Assignment

Assignment shall mean consecutive teaching days in one (1) position.

14.09 Clauses that Apply

The following clauses in the collective agreement shall be operational for substitute teachers: 

Article 1                Agreement

Article 2                Effective Date and Period

Article 3.01           Salary Schedule

Article 3.03           Classification

Article 5                Proof of Qualifications

Article 15              Settlement of Differences (only for clauses which apply to substitute teachers)

Article 16              Written Warnings and Suspensions

Article 22              Freedom from Violence

14.10 Other Provisions Not to Apply

The provisions of the collective agreement do not apply to substitute teachers except as expressly provided for in Article 14, Substitute Teachers.

14.11 Settlement of Differences

The only matters which may be grieved under Article 15 (Settlement of Differences) by a substitute teacher or the Association on behalf of a substitute teacher are the provisions of this Article, and the substantive rights and obligations of employment related and human rights statutes, to the extent that they are incorporated into this collective agreement.

14.12 Call In

A substitute teacher who is called to work and reports for the assignment finding that his or her services are not required shall be offered an alternative assignment at that school of not less than a half (1/2) day.
